Good question about recent visits since earlier reports and my own experience were awful. I will be curious because I hope it has improved.
I was there pre-hurricane, so the condo we rented was fine but at that time, they nickeled and dimed you to death for every single breath you took. It is also a l-o-n-g way from the nearest supermarket, should you have plans for cooking. The distance as the crow flies isn't so bad, but at the posted (and patrolled) 35 MPH speed limit, it takes a long time.

I was there in March and it is beautiful. We stayed in a Harborside Waterview room which was great- a balcony one floor up from the sand where we could watch dolphins and herons and ospreys and a raccoon who slept in the palm tree. The room was big with two queen beds and a table and chairs with an amazing bathroom. We requested a microwave which they brought for no charge. It was a lovely vacation!
